Global COVID-19 Vaccine Spending Estimated At $157bn Through 2025 By IQVIA
Executive Summary
Vaccine spending projections represent about 2% of total spending on medicines IQVIA said. Increased spending will be partly offset by COIVD-19 disruptions, however.
